A pedestrian was killed after being struck by a reversing vehicle in North Ipswich on the night of August 27, Queensland Police said. The Forensic Crash Unit is investigating the incident.

Police said an 81-year-old woman was on Simmons Road at about 10:35 p.m. when a white Nissan X-Trail reversed into her, knocking her to the ground. She suffered serious head injuries and was pronounced dead at the scene.

The 84-year-old driver of the vehicle was not physically injured and is assisting police with their inquiries. Investigators are appealing for witnesses and anyone with dashcam footage to come forward.
